What they do
THE MISSION of TALL TIMBERS RESEARCH,INC. is to FOSTER EXEMPLARY LAND STEWARDSHIP THROUGH RESEARCH, CONSERVATION and EDUCATION.OUR PRIMARY RESEARCH FOCUS is THE ECOLOGY of FIRE and NATURAL RESOURCE MANAGEMENT INCLUDING BOBWHITE QUAIL and OTHER WILDLIFE IN THE SOUTHEASTERN COASTAL PLAIN. OUR CONSERVATION EFFORTS ARE DEDICATED to HELPING PROTECT THE DISTINCTIVE RED HILLS LANDSCAPE of SOUTH GEORGIA and NORTH FLORIDA, and ITS TRADITIONAL LAND USES. OUR EDUCATION PROGRAM TRANSFERS RESEARCH and CONSERVATION INFORMATION for RESOURCE MANAGEMENT.DEFINING EXEMPLARY LAND STEWARDSHIP EXEMPLARY LAND STEWARDSHIP (ELS) BALANCES ECOLOGICAL VALUES and ECONOMIC UTILITY WITHIN A FRAMEWORK of LONG-TERM CONSERVATION. THE FOUNDATION of ELS ON UPLAND HABITATS IN THE RED HILLS is THE FREQUENT USE of FIRE to ACCOMMODATE MANAGEMENT for BOBWHITE QUAIL, SELECTION TIMBER HARVEST, and OTHER TRADITIONAL LAND USES. SCENIC, OPEN MULTI-AGED FOREST STRUCTURES ARE FUNDAMENTAL to ELS.
